Sony 57 Inch XBR 2001

I have the Sony HD 57 inch Rear Projection XBR, that I purchased in 2001. We have just recently hooked it up to a HD cable box. I have not noticed a significant change in the picture quality. I have inputs going into the red, green and blue HD inputs. Do I also need inputs into the HD and VD inputs? What else could be wrong? Or are my expectations of picture quality too high for such an old TV?

I don't have the XBR, but on my sony, using the cable box remote, I had to go into menu/display/etc. and mark the 1080i, 720p, and 480i settings. you usually get a "if you can see this" comment if your tv accepts the settings. for standard tv i set the screen to normal, and when the upper channels go to HD, they auto go to full screen. Sounds like you are using the component cable, and also make sure you are on the video port of remote, and the the TV input. The above worked for mine. Hope it helps.

I want to know what type of cable wire do you need to hook up for HDTV and where you hook it up at on the TV

HD can come from two types of cables. A RF cable, normally it is a RG 6 or maybe a RG 59 coax cable. A HDMI cable is the other method of obtaining HD on your HDTV. A HDMI cable has a rectangular shape with small pins, its about 1/2 inch wide by 1/8 inch in height. The RF connector is about 1/4 in circular. A HD signal can come from a cable box or it can come from a DVD or Blue Ray player. Google these type of cables and look on your TV for the connectors.
